Scientific publishing guides are comprehensive resources designed to assist researchers, students, and academics in navigating the complex process of publishing scientific work. They typically cover topics such as manuscript preparation, journal selection, peer review processes, ethical considerations, and submission guidelines, aiming to improve the quality and success rate of scientific publications.

Key Features

  • Step-by-step instructions for manuscript writing and submission
  • Guidance on choosing appropriate journals and publishers
  • Ethical standards and compliance information
  • Tips for responding to peer review feedback
  • Advice on open access, copyright, and licensing issues
  • Updates on publishing trends and technological tools

Pros

  • Provides clear and practical guidance for authors new to scientific publishing
  • Helps improve manuscript quality and adherence to standards
  • Offers insights into navigating the peer review process effectively
  • Promotes awareness of ethical considerations in publishing

Cons

  • Can be overwhelming or overly technical for beginners without prior experience
  • Some guides may become outdated due to rapid changes in publishing practices
  • Lack of coverage on emerging alternative publishing models like preprints or open peer review
